Abstract: In spite of its extent, competitive balance literature lets unexplored leads. It cares about a too restric-tive view according to which only outcome uncertainty explains demand and only the reach of competitive balance generates outcome uncertainty. Our article consists of developing a model which makes possible to mitigate competitive balance lacks. To do it, we conceptualize competitive intensity, initially proposed by Kringstad and Gerrard, as a dimension integrating outcome uncer-tainty – including in situation of imbalance between teams – but also sports stakes and reversals. The will is to approach in a best way the attractiveness of sport-spectacle. Extended competitive intensity model has two scales: intra-match and intra-championship. The subject of the article is the theoreti-cal and methodological elaboration of the model. Consequently, key notions are defined (state of the score at intra-match level, strategic ranks at intra-championship scale). They condition the model which bases on objective choices in terms of thresholds of outcome uncertainty and raises manage-rial implications.
